The Misconception of a Single “Number One” Supplement
In the search for a quick fix for fatigue, many people seek a definitive “best” energy supplement. The truth, however, is that there is no universal number one. Energy is a complex process involving various bodily systems, and a supplement's effectiveness is tied to the specific reason you're feeling drained. For some, a deficiency in a key nutrient may be the cause, while for others, enhanced cellular function or quick stimulation is needed. Instead of chasing a single miracle pill, a more effective approach is to understand how different supplements work and identify which best addresses your unique situation.
Key Contributors to Energy Production
Your body's energy is governed by several factors, and various supplements target different pathways to provide a lift. A comprehensive approach considers a range of ingredients, each with a specific role.
-
Caffeine: A central nervous system stimulant, caffeine is perhaps the most well-known energy booster. It works by blocking adenosine, a neurotransmitter that promotes relaxation and drowsiness, which in turn increases alertness and reduces the perception of fatigue. It's a short-term solution, offering a quick lift, but overuse can lead to dependence, jitters, and sleep disruption. Combining caffeine with L-theanine can help mitigate some of the negative side effects.
-
B Vitamins (especially B12): The entire B-complex plays a vital role in converting food into usable energy (ATP). Vitamin B12, in particular, is critical for red blood cell formation and neurological function. For individuals with a B12 deficiency, supplementation can significantly alleviate fatigue. Vegans, vegetarians, and older adults are at a higher risk of deficiency. Taking a B-complex vitamin can ensure you get all the B vitamins necessary for energy metabolism.
-
Creatine: Widely used by athletes, creatine is best for high-intensity, short-duration activities. It helps regenerate adenosine triphosphate (ATP), the body's primary energy molecule, allowing muscles to perform stronger and longer. While primarily known for physical performance, it may also support brain function by providing quick energy for demanding mental tasks.
-
Iron: Iron is a component of hemoglobin, which transports oxygen throughout the body. Iron deficiency, or anemia, is a common cause of fatigue, especially in women and those with certain dietary restrictions. An iron supplement, prescribed after a blood test, can be highly effective in reversing this type of tiredness.
-
Coenzyme Q10 (CoQ10): This antioxidant is naturally produced by the body and is essential for energy production at the cellular level. Natural CoQ10 levels decline with age, and supplementation has been shown to reduce fatigue, particularly in individuals with lower natural levels or chronic conditions.
-
Adaptogens: Herbs like Ashwagandha and Rhodiola Rosea are known as adaptogens because they help the body adapt to stress. By lowering cortisol levels (the stress hormone), Ashwagandha can indirectly boost energy by improving sleep and reducing anxiety. Rhodiola can help combat mental and physical fatigue, improving stamina and concentration. They offer a less immediate but more balanced approach to sustained energy compared to stimulants.
Comparing Popular Energy-Boosting Supplements
| Supplement | Mechanism of Action | Speed of Effect | Best For... | Best Time to Take | Potential Side Effects |
|---|---|---|---|---|---|
| Caffeine | Blocks adenosine receptors in the brain, increasing alertness. | Fast (20-60 minutes). | Quick alertness, athletic performance. | Morning/early afternoon. | Jitters, anxiety, dependence, sleep disruption. |
| B Vitamins | Co-enzymes that convert food to cellular energy (ATP). | Gradual (weeks to see results if deficient). | Correcting deficiencies (common in vegans, elderly). | Morning with food. | Generally mild; high doses may cause issues. |
| Creatine | Replenishes ATP stores for high-intensity muscle contractions. | Variable; builds up over days/weeks. | High-intensity exercise, muscle growth. | Pre- or post-workout. | Water retention, GI discomfort. |
| Iron | Carries oxygen in blood via hemoglobin. | Gradual (months to rebuild stores if deficient). | Anemia, individuals with heavy periods. | Best absorbed on an empty stomach. | Stomach upset, constipation. |
| Coenzyme Q10 | Antioxidant that supports cellular energy production. | Gradual (months for noticeable effect). | Age-related fatigue, general fatigue. | With meals for better absorption. | Mild GI upset. |
| Adaptogens | Helps body manage stress, improves resilience. | Gradual (weeks to feel effect). | Stress-induced fatigue, mental clarity. | Consult product guidelines. | Can vary; consult a doctor. |
The Importance of a Wholesome Diet and Lifestyle
Before turning to supplements, it’s crucial to remember that no pill can substitute for a healthy diet and lifestyle. Addressing underlying issues is the most sustainable path to long-term, natural energy. The foundation of your energy should come from whole, nutritious foods that provide a steady supply of fuel, rather than processed foods that lead to blood sugar spikes and crashes.
Here are some fundamental steps to boost your energy naturally:
- Prioritize adequate sleep: Insufficient sleep is a major cause of fatigue. Aim for 7-9 hours of quality sleep per night. A consistent sleep schedule can help regulate your body's natural clock.
- Eat a balanced diet: Ensure your meals are rich in whole foods, including lean proteins, whole grains, fruits, and vegetables. Carbohydrates from whole grains provide sustained energy, while lean protein helps prevent crashes. Include healthy fats from sources like fish and nuts.
- Stay hydrated: Dehydration can lead to feelings of sluggishness and fatigue. Drinking enough water throughout the day is critical for maintaining optimal energy levels.
- Engage in regular physical activity: Exercise, even at a low to moderate intensity, can significantly increase your natural energy levels and reduce fatigue. Regular movement improves circulation and strengthens the body's energy systems.
- Manage stress: Chronic stress can drain your energy reserves. Techniques like meditation, mindfulness, and adaptogens can help manage stress and support a more resilient energy state.
Conclusion: A Personalized Path to Better Energy
Ultimately, the quest to find what is the number one energy supplement leads to a more nuanced answer: it’s the one that best matches your body's specific needs. For an immediate, short-term boost, caffeine remains a powerful option. For long-term athletic performance, creatine is a proven choice. However, for many, the solution isn't in a stimulant but in addressing underlying deficiencies through targeted vitamins like B12, iron, or vitamin D. A personalized approach, guided by your diet, lifestyle, and potential nutritional gaps, is far more effective than any single supplement could ever be. Always consult a healthcare professional before starting any new supplement regimen, especially to test for deficiencies and avoid adverse interactions.
